>>   Out of curiosity, what was the failure mode of that power supply?
> 
> In my power supply the problem was caused by failed capacitor, there was
> four nichicon 1800uf 25v caps that has leaked all over the board and
> corroded some of the solder joint in the pcb, every other caps in the
> psu was fine except this four, replaced them, cleaned the pcb, redone
> the damaged solder joint and the power supply is now working as is
> should, before the repair it was totaly dead, no voltage on any rail, no
> power led, not even the classic ticking sound of a switching psu in trouble.

  Nice recovery.  Thanks for the info.  We have a number of machines
that use the H7821 power supply in storage at LSSM.  We've begun
construction of a new exhibit floor on which some of these machines will
be shown off, so I've made a note of your PSU's failure mode to keep
handy when we start digging into those machines.
